Flakey Skin
Hey i have noticed that Tony has a lot of flakey skin under his black coat, it has been there since i got him from the GAP kennels.
Just wondering why his skin would be so flakey? And is there anyway to help remove the skin? It has been looking a little better the last few days but i thought id ask. Thanks in advance. |
just dry skin, if you dont know what he was being fed before its probably due to that
chuck a teaspoon of cod liver oil over the top of his food twice a week and see how that goes. most of dogs external problems are traced to an internal cause. As for removing the skin just give him a nice bath and a scrub should take some of it off. |

Brushing will only make the matter worse as the brush pulls up more dead skin.
Bottle of sprint oil to feed nightly with as myanimall said 1 teaspoon of cod liver oil twice a week should have the coat looking spot on - But of course it doesnt happen overnight - Give it a good 2-3 weeks. A bath every 4-5 days with anti doggy dandruff shampoo should do wanders. |
